The second Hideaway on São Miguel is located in a very special place: in the middle of a volcanic crater in the village of Furnas. The environment here is spectacular …. It is very green with lots of ferns and beautiful flowers, everywhere there are geysers steaming and hot springs bubbling. It creates a mysterious atmosphere and the village looks a bit like a film set. The biggest plus of this hotel is its own thermal springs (both indoors and outdoors), which guests can use 24 hours a day.

From your lounger at the edge of the infinity pool, staring at the sheep grazing over the hills… it does not get any more Alentejo Zen! At 45 minutes from Lisbon airport, we discovered this new gem. A recently completely renovated farmhouse, the house of the grandparents of the dear hostess Dona Toia, is now a charming bed & breakfast with 5 suites. All with their own terrace, bathroom and fully equipped kitchen. But this is not all, the family now owns 3 townhouses in the historic town of Alcácer do Sal, 10 minutes by car, which are also rented out.
